Accommodation
All units are built to the new The Animal Welfare (Licensing of Activities Involving Animals) (England) Regulations 2018, approved and regularly inspected by Wealden District Council (licence number: 33489).
The accommodation consists of 10 luxury chalets set in our beautiful garden, which is overlooked by our home. All the chalets are insulated and have thermostatically controlled heating in the sleeping area and an exercise run with scratching post and shelving where the cats can relax and watch the birds outside on the bird feeders or the squirrels in the trees.
Our chalets provide a clean and hygienic environment for your cats stay and the full height opaque sneeze barriers between each chalet ensures there is no contact between the cats thus reducing any risk of cross infection. All chalets are fully cleaned and disinfected between occupancies. Scratch posts, beds, bedding and toys are provided but owners are more than welcome to bring their cats favourite blanket or toy with them to remind them of home and help them settle in.
If boarding more than one cat you agree that they can share a room and give us authority to separate them if necessary.
For added security there is a safety corridor between the chalets and the outside world and we operate a 2-door system (one door is closed before another is opened) so the cats cannot escape. In addition, the cattery has CCTV cameras, lights and the doors are secured at all times. Fire safety is also very important to us: the cattery has heat & smoke detectors throughout and the alarms are linked to our house and we have fire extinguishers throughout the cattery. The premises are occupied 24/7.
Health
Vaccinations
Only cats that have a current vaccination certificate against Feline Infectious Enteritis and upper respiratory infections (Cat Flu) can be accepted for boarding and owners must produce an up to date inoculation certificate on arrival. Cats without proof of the appropriate up to date certificate will not be accepted for boarding. Homeopathic vaccinations are not acceptable under our licence conditions.
Primary vaccinations must not have been administered any less than ten days prior to boarding in order to protect our other residents from possible infection. Please note that only vaccinated kittens can be accepted.
If you arrive at drop-off without being able to provide evidence of current vaccinations, your cat(s) will not be accepted, and the full boarding fee will still be charged.
Neutered cats
Unfortunately cats over the age of 6 months that have not been neutered cannot be boarded with us, due to their habit of spraying, and this can present an infection hazard.

Collars
All collars will be removed while your cat(s) are boarding with us. This recommendation comes from the Chartered Institute of Environmental Health, Model License Conditions and Guidance for Cat Boarding Establishments and reduces the risk of injury.

Diet
We provide Harringtons and Whiskas wet and dry food as our standard diet. If your cat does not usually eat these brands at home, or is on a specialist or veterinary-prescribed diet, we kindly ask that you provide their usual food for the duration of their stay. This helps to keep them comfortable, as sudden changes to a cat’s diet can sometimes cause digestive upset. If suitable food is not provided, we will do our best to purchase your cat’s usual food on your behalf, and the cost will be added to your bill. Please note that this may also include any applicable delivery charges.
If allowed, we can give them occasional treats including fresh fish or chicken, Lick-e-Lik, Dreamies and meat sticks.
